MRF2947RAT2 Specs and Replacement
Type Designator: MRF2947RAT2
SMD Transistor Code: XR
Material of Transistor: Si
Polarity: NPN
Absolute Maximum Ratings
Maximum Collector Power Dissipation (Pc): 0.188 W
Maximum Collector-Base Voltage |Vcb|: 20 V
Maximum Collector-Emitter Voltage |Vce|: 10 V
Maximum Emitter-Base Voltage |Veb|: 1.5 V
Maximum Collector Current |Ic max|: 0.05 A
Max. Operating Junction Temperature (Tj): 150 °C
Electrical Characteristics
Transition Frequency (ft): 9000 MHz
Collector Capacitance (Cc): 0.42 pF
Forward Current Transfer Ratio (hFE), MIN: 75
Package: SOT363
